Review Meta AnalysisCigarette smoking and testosterone in men and women: A systematic review and meta-analysis of observational studies.
Recently Health Canada and the Food and Drug Administration warned about the cardiovascular risk of testosterone, making environmental drivers of testosterone potential prevention targets. Cotinine, a tobacco metabolite, inhibits testosterone breakdown. We assessed the association of smoking with testosterone in a systematic review and meta-analysis, searching PubMed and Web of Science through March 2015 using ("testosterone" or "androgen" or "sex hormone") and ("smoking" or "cigarette"). ⋯ In 6 studies of 6089 women, mean age 28-62years, smoking was not clearly associated with testosterone (0.11nmol/L, 95% CI -0.08 to 0.30). Fixed effects models provided similar results, but suggested a positive association in women. Whether products which raise cotinine, such as e-cigarettes or nicotine replacement, also raise testosterone, should be investigated, to inform any regulatory action for e-cigarettes, which emit nicotine into the surrounding air, with relevance for both active and passive smokers.

The association between social media use and sleep disturbance among young adults.
Many factors contribute to sleep disturbance among young adults. Social media (SM) use is increasing rapidly, and little is known regarding its association with sleep disturbance. ⋯ The strong association between SM use and sleep disturbance has important clinical implications for the health and well-being of young adults. Future work should aim to assess directionality and to better understand the influence of contextual factors associated with SM use.

Review Meta AnalysisOrthostatic hypotension and the risk of incidental cardiovascular diseases: A meta-analysis of prospective cohort studies.
To quantitatively estimate the prospective associations between orthostatic hypotension (OH) and cardiovascular diseases, including coronary heart disease (CHD) and stroke. ⋯ Presence of OH was independently related to significantly increased risk for incidence of CHD and stroke. Further, studies regarding the mechanisms and potential treatments for OH may be important for understanding whether the associations between OH and cardiovascular diseases are causative.

Assessment of tobacco smoke exposure in the pediatric emergency department.
Tobacco smoke exposure causes significant childhood morbidity and is associated with a multitude of conditions. National organizations recommend tobacco smoke exposure screening at all pediatric clinical encounters. Data regarding tobacco smoke exposure screening in the pediatric emergency department is sparse, although children with tobacco smoke exposure-associated conditions commonly present to this setting. We aimed to determine the frequency and outcome of tobacco smoke exposure screening in the pediatric emergency department, and assess associated sociodemographic/clinical characteristics. ⋯ Despite national recommendations, current tobacco smoke exposure screening rates are low and fail to identify at-risk children. Pediatric emergency department visits for tobacco smoke exposure-associated conditions are common, thus further research is needed to develop and assess standardized tobacco smoke exposure screening tools/interventions in this setting.

Mode-specific physical activity and leukocyte telomere length among U.S. adults: Implications of running on cellular aging.
Previous research demonstrates that physical activity participation is associated with longer leukocyte telomere length, with shorter leukocyte telomere length being a hallmark characteristic of cellular aging. What remains under-investigated, however, is whether there is a mode-specific association of physical activity on leukocyte telomere length, which was this study's purpose. ⋯ Running-specific physical activity was the only evaluated physical activity associated with leukocyte telomere length, which may provide one potential mechanism (i.e., leukocyte telomere length) through which running-based physical activity may help to prevent cardiovascular disease and premature mortality.
